I picked up this Stevens Model 94 in 20 gauge from a co-worker last week. She had never shot it. It belonged to her father who passed away over 20 years ago. Serial number shows it was made in 1978.  I added a shell holder and recoil pad. It is the 13th shotgun in my current collection (I have sold one and given away 2).

I took it to the range Saturday and it functions fine. The ejecter will sling an empty shell across the range when you break it open.
